Revlon - Just Bitten Kissable Lip Balm Stain

The packaging is actually a beautiful vibrant pink!

It’s no secret I love a bold lip! It can give a nice finish to ANY makeup look.
  
I recently picked up the Revlon Just Bitten Kissable Balm Stain (not to be confused with the plain lipstain) in the color Sweetheart Valentine. Let me tell you - This product is amazing!

The initial color is super pigmented and incredibly easy to apply. The product is crème based rather than many of the ‘texta type’ lip stains that are around at the moment.

Excuse the dodgy pic - but you get the idea! This color is BRIGHT!
The initial boldness doesn’t last the longest of time (about as long as a normal lippie) However, the product leaves a nice color on the lip which lasts a super long time. 

The packaging is great! It is a strong plastic tube and the actual stain is a twist up crayon, which allows for easy application. 

The product retails for around $17.95 however, I picked it up at the ‘Chemist Warehouse’ 50% off sale, so grabbed it for around $9.

Sally Hansen Hard as Nails Xtreme Wear Nail Color - First Blush


If you can't tell from my previous posts, I'm currently going through a pink/pastels phase. I'm not sure why, as I'm normally more adventuresome with my color choices, but lately, I just can't get enough of the pinks.

I recently picked up this Sally Hansen Hard as Nails Xtreme Wear Nail Color from Chemist warehouse for only $4.95. I picked up the color First Blush.

I won't lie, I think it may be love! The packing is cute which I really love. I like how the bottle is 'slim' as it makes it easier to hold when you are fixing a nail on the go. The brush is a great size for application and the polish has a nice shine.

The only downside to this color, is that it isn't terribly opaque. However, I'm certain that it's just this color as I have other colors from the same range and they are beautiful.


The polish has AMAZING staying power - It fades before it chips which is a massive PLUS in my books

I highly recommend this polish if you are looking for a nice natural nail. Also, the Sally Hansen line is amazing so if pink isn't your color - I strongly recommend other in the line.

Essence: 'Stay With Me – Long Lasting Lip Gloss’



I wont lie, I’m a sucker for a nice lipgloss – but I simply can’t justify spending a crazy amount of money on it, as I don’t feel as though its something that has a lot of longevity in my makeup collection.

 Needless to say, I was super excited when I found the Essence ‘Stay With Me – Long Lasting Lip Gloss’ for around (possibly under) the $5 mark.

I chose the color 02 My Favorite Milkshake. The color is a nice light pink color, with a lovely shine. 

My Nan wanted to help, so gave me her hand - such a cutie

The first thing I noticed about this was the odd shaped applicator wand. As you can see, it dips in the middle, making it slightly awkward to apply the gloss evenly. The packing also has a stopper in the tube (not pictured) so its slightly difficult to get a good amount of product on the wand when applying.

This is 2 coats swatched on my wrist
It is fairly translucent color wise, but has a nice shine to it, which is something I look for in a gloss.

To be honest, I’m not sure the product lives up to its name, as its not extremely long lasting – It’s certainly no longer lasting than any other gloss that I have in my collection. 

Finished Product - my lips were super dark here. Not sure why haha
 However, having said that, I am fairly happy with this product, especially for the price.  It is a great product to use over a dark color for added effect or on days where I don’t want a super dramatic lip

Palmers Cocoa Butter Formula - Gentle Exfoliating Facial Scrub

Sold at most supermarkets/Priceline for around $10

I am currently adoring this exfoliant and thought I'd share it with anyone that reads this blog.

I picked this up from Woolworths (standard supermarket) for around $10.

I have extremely confused (weird) skin. Sometimes it's oily, other times its dry. While I don't suffer from sensitive skin, there's many a product that will leave me with a slight redness after application - so for me this product was a godsend!

The packaging is simple yet practical. You only need the smallest amount of product to cover your whole face. I have been using this product for 3 weeks now and I feel as though there is still plenty left. The micro beads in the formula are not too harsh on the skin, and the product has an amazing scent!

After an initial breakout, my skin is looking and feeling amazing! (If i do say so myself)
